This sketch shows a man’s face turned slightly to the left. His hair is wild and curly, spilling over his forehead, and a thick beard covers his chin. The lines are loose and scratchy, almost like quick strokes with a pen. The artist focused on texture—every strand of hair and wrinkle is drawn with tiny, fast marks.
